D3287 - Gell family of Hopton Hall, Wirksworth - [13th-20th cent]
MIL - Correspondence mostly between P.L. Gell and Alfred Milner (created 1st Viscount Milner) - 1871-1959
1 - Correspondence mostly between P.L. Gell and Alfred Milner (cr. Viscount Milner) - 1871-1959
Browse this collection
This entry describes an individual archive record or file. Click here to browse the full catalogue for this collection
Archive Reference / Library Class No.
D3287/MIL/1/363-364
Title
Milner, Cape Town, to Mrs. Gell: staying at their country house at Newlands;
description of recent tour of east of Cape Colony;
very hard work;
sending of G(eorge) V(andaleur) Fiddes as his Imperial Secretary will be very useful;
sure P.L.G. would not have been suited, he must take to his pen again;
thanks for account of Lady Wantage's house party;
impending trip to Bulawayo, will be out of place amongst all Rhodes' friends;
encloses photograph of himself and party.
Date
1897 Oct 12
